Rana Fawad Enjoying PSL Wining Time With Family

Lahore Qalandars franchise owner Fawad Rana explained the reason for not coming to the stadium in three consecutive victories in the team event.

Talking to Yahya Hussaini, the host of Geo News program ‘Score’, Rana Fawad said about his absence from the ground that the impression is wrong that my heart was broken, I have drowned many times in my life and even managed to fall.

Fawad Rana said that I am from Lahore and I will always be with Lahore Qalandars.

“America’s time on a business conference call prevented me from going to the stadium, which is why I didn’t show up at the stadium to cheer on the team, but I’m happy to say that the team won,” he said. He must have enjoyed every moment.

Fawad Rana added that when the team reached the hotel after winning, Fawad Rana was the first to greet the players at the hotel reception.

Fawad Rana, owner of Lahore Qalandars franchise, has vowed to visit Lahore Qalandar and Peshawar Zalmi in Sharjah today.

Lahore Qalandars made it to the final of the 7th edition of Pakistan Super League (PSL) in Lahore.

The final of the 7th edition of PSL was played between Lahore Qalandars and Multan Sultans and thousands of spectators flocked to the stadium to watch the match.

Cricket fans started remembering Lahore Qalandars owner Fawad Rana in this important match and this was expressed by many fans by carrying placards.

It can be seen in the pictures that the cricket fan is holding a placard on which the picture of Fawad Rana is affixed. The card features the song ‘Nadan Parande Ghar Aaja’ from the Indian movie ‘Rock Star’.

It may be recalled that even in this year’s edition of PSL, Lahore Qalandars owner Fawad Rana was absent from the ground while his presence in the ground and his attachment to cricket is highly appreciated by the fans.
